Transaction d73a4712f36638b680d00a9a876b5ee5ab76550277f63a9dc04ccddf31f4cf4a

block
ee809fa38b97a93a78018213bf34589b49ba1c44c368f2a914b013712f9fcbf6

1 Input

23 Outputs